According to TechCrunch.com on 7/22, the Internet Giant Google is negotiating to buy Digg for around $200M and the rumors are spreading all over the blogsphere and the Internet - Some reports that they already have signed a letter of intent. This is the third time the buyout rumor has surfaced again after March in this year.



Google In Final Negotiations To Acquire Digg For Around $200 Million


Why Digg?



Despite of the recent number of unique visitors compared to it's biggest competitor, Yahoo Buzz, why can't Google build their own Digg, but buy Digg? The below may be the possible reasons so far.



1. The first possible reason is that Google is interested in "social search."

The Google brain is moving their interest to the relationship between the preference of the person who votes the articles and the articles themselves. So Google may not want to put their efforts building the site but "social search" based on the existing organized community site such as Digg.






2. Second, Digg currently has 3 years advertising contract with MS and the deal would be terminated if Google buys Digg. We may see some interesting reaction by MS since MS lose the game of Yahoo search advertisement by Google.







What would be the challenges?



1. "The beginning of the end" said by some blogger after this rumor. What does it mean?



After many Web 2.0 related sites have been opened, the people post their idea, thoughts, and the story and exchange them in those sites. However some of the major Web 2.0 sites such as YouTube, Flickr, and Facebooks acquired by big companies, the free becomes the limitation and the rules.

If this deal is closed and Google has Digg under their umbrella, would Google do the content moderation or something? Can we still keep posting our idea or thoughts around the blogsphere without BIG G's control?



2. The recent data by ComScore regarding June traffic shows that Digg has 6.2 million and Yahoo Buzz, the major competitor, has 9.2 million.

In addition, Propeller, the social network site by AOL, is re-launched with new look and feel and is integrated with AOL. So this competition may be the headache to Google.



Social Networking Sites Comparison


The number of unique visitors on Digg


3. Google does not care after they buy Digg?

We have seen the case that Google only has added the AdSense in the feed without any improvements after they bought Feedburner about $100M in the last June 2007. What would Google do with Digg?







About Digg



Digg was launched in November 2004 by a group of young entrepreneurs including Kevin Rose and is one of the best-known social network site.

Digg initially gave the side impact to the several Website providers including Wordpress to crash due to the increased traffic, called "Digg Effect."



Digg Main Page




In this third time rumors seems more specific and more realistic that Google will buy Digg and especially most bloggers are interested in how it goes. We basically want to see whether Google can develop "social search" based on Digg and upgrade the blogsphere to the next level or Google just wants to use Digg as their business and govern the blogsphere under their control.

In my previous post - Ads Theme Template Error Fix - I explained how to fix the JavaScrip Error on Search Widget on Ads Theme Template.



This post will give you how to correct Archives Widget if you are using Ads Theme Template and having problem using Archives Widget.



Hierarchy Archives




1. Download the existing XML template and make a copy in your PC.



2. Open the copy of XML and search the below Archives Widget code.



<b:includable id='main'>

<b:if cond='data:title'>

<h2><data:title/></h2>

</b:if>

<div class='widget-content'>

<div id='ArchiveList'>

<div expr:id='data:widget.instanceId + &quot;_ArchiveList&quot;'>

<b:include data='data' name='flat'/>

</div>

</div>

</div>

</b:includable>


3. Replace the above entire code to the below code and upload the XML into your Blogger.



<b:includable id='main'>

<b:if cond='data:title'>

<h2><data:title/></h2>

</b:if>

<div class='widget-content'>

<div id='ArchiveList'>

<div expr:id='data:widget.instanceId + &quot;_ArchiveList&quot;'>

<b:if cond='data:style == &quot;HIERARCHY&quot;'>

<b:include data='data' name='interval'/>

</b:if>

<b:if cond='data:style == &quot;FLAT&quot;'>


<b:include data='data' name='flat'/>

</b:if>

<b:if cond='data:style == &quot;MENU&quot;'>

<b:include data='data' name='menu'/>

</b:if>


</div>

</div>

<b:include name='quickedit'/>

</div>

</b:includable>


Basically the original XML template does not have the condition for each style. Now you can use your layout/page element to change the style - Hierarchy, Flat List, or Dropdown Menu.

If you plan to use VoIP service for your long distance calls, I gave you the little tips how to use Skype in my previous post - Cheap Long Distance Calls Unlimited with Skype.



In this topic, we will cover how to set up VoSKY Call Center as your Adaptor.



Again you can buy VoSKY Call Center from the below locations.

If you purchased a VoSKY Call Center and open the box, you will see Call Center, USB Cable, Telephone Cable, User Guide, and CD ROM in the box. VoSKY Call Center does not require external power and is compatible with Windows XP, 2000, and Vista.



In order to set up, you will need to install Skype S/W and Internet connection is required.



1. Single-Line Connection (if you do not have a regular phone service)

1) Insert the phone cable from the telephone into "Phone" port on Call Center.

2) Connect the other end to the telephone.



2. Dual-Line Connection (if you have a regular phone service)

1) DSL Modem: Insert the supplied phone cable in the "Line" port of Call Center and insert the other end in the micro filter. Insert the other end from the telephone in the "Phone" port of Call Center.

2) Cable Modem: Insert the supplied phone cable in the "Line" port of Call center and insert the other end in the "Phone" port of the DSL filter. Insert the other end from the telephone in the "Phone" port of Call Center.



3. Install Call Center S/W

1) Insert the Installation CD in your PC and follow the step during the installation.

2) Once finished, connect the supplied USB cable to the computer's USB port and click NEXT.

3) Enter your email address and click NEXT.

4) Wait for the Call Center application to launch and click OK with "Allow this program to use Skype".

If you use Blogger, you may see annoying comment feature that you have to either open the new window or open the seperate page that does not look like your blog.



However if you use Blogger in Draft, there is the way you can add inline comment in your blog.



Let's find out how to do add inline comment in your blog.



1. Login into Blogger in Draft.



Blogger in Draft Homepage


2. Settings | Comments | Comment Form Placement

Select "Embedded below post" radio button and save it.



Select Embedded below post


3. See if your blog has inline comment or not as below



Inline comment blog


If you are using the default template by Blogger, you may see inline comment, however if you are using the custom template like I do, you have to do more steps. Don't worry! It is too easy to follow.



4. Layout | Edit HTML | Download Full Template

Download the current template and make it as a copy for something happens.



Download the Current Template


5. Open the XML file and search the "data:postCommentMsg".

<p class='comment-footer'>

<a expr:href='data:post.addCommentUrl' expr:onclick='data:post.addCommentOnclick'><data:postCommentMsg/></a>

</p>


6. Replace the entire section of the above code to the below and save it.

<p class='comment-footer'>

<b:if cond='data:post.embedCommentForm'><b:include data='post' name='comment-form'/>

<b:else/><b:if cond='data:post.allowComments'>

<a expr:href='data:post.addCommentUrl' expr:onclick='data:post.addCommentOnclick'><data:postCommentMsg/></a>

</b:if></b:if>

</p>


7. Upload the updated XML file to Blogger and see if the inline comment is existed.



8. Additional Tip

If you click any of the comments under your "Recent Comments" section, it goes to the post page for the comment. Not bad at least it goes to the page. However, if you have so many comments for the post, it is hard to find out where the comment is located.



Here is what you can do:

Search "data:comment.id" from your XML file

<a expr:name='"comment-" + data:comment.id'/>


Replace "comment" to "c" and save it, and upload the XML to Blogger.

<a expr:name='&quot;c&quot; + data:comment.id'/>


You can even find out where the comment is located by clicking any comment under "Recent Comments" section. Sounds better?



Click any comment under Recent Comments


Point where the comment is located


Now you know how to add inline comment in your Blogger and enjoy the new feature!

Same as Google, Yahoo also provides the similar service called Yahoo Site Explorer that you can submit your Sitemap to them.



Here's how to submit:



1. Go to Yahoo Site Explorer and type your URL in the "Site Explorer" box.



If you see the results, your Sitemap has been submitted already. Otherwise, please do the step 2 below.

Yahoo Site Explorer


2. Enter your URL into "My Sites" and you will need to login into Yahoo.



Add my site to Yahoo


3. Once you login, click the authenticate button.

You will need to either download verification file to upload into your site or add a META tag to your homepage.



4. Once the step 3 is done, click "Ready to Authenticate" button to Yahoo to verify which takes whithin 24 hours.



5. While Yahoo is checking your site, you can even submit your Sitemap by adding "atom.xml".



Submit Sitemap to Yahoo


Ping Yahoo

Yahoo Site Explorer also provides the API for us to notify Yahoo when the site has been updated. You can simply change the below URL to your URL and type it in the browser and enter.

http://search.yahooapis.com/SiteExplorerService/V1/ping?sitemap=http://www.findcheapworld.com


If there are no issues, you can see the below screen.

Ping to Yahoo


Now you will just wait couple of days and see your site results from Yahoo after submitting the Sitemap to Yahoo.

Submitting a Sitemap to Google Webmaster Tools provides Google about your site and posts. However I recently found the article "How do I create a Sitemap file?" from Google Webmaster Help Center that You don't need to submit your Sitemap to Google Webmaster Tools if you use a Blogger.



Blogger automatically submits a Sitemap for you



Even though the article says so, I decided to submit my Sitemap to Google becasue I am not 100% sure how it works and it does not cost or hurt me even if I submit it.















Here's how!



1. If you do not have Google Webmaster Tools account, you can register by visiting Google Webmaster Tools.



Google Webmaster Tools


2. If you do not use a redirected custom feed such as FeedBurner, type "atom.xml" and click "Add General Web Sitemap" button.



Add Sitemap


3. If you do use a redirected custome feed such as FeedBurner, type "atom.xml?redirect=false".





Otherwise you will see "URL not allowed" error because the sitemap you have submitted to Google Webmaster Tools is actually redirecting to the FeedBurner feed URL not your site URL. And your Sitemap contains a URL that is not allowed based on the Sitemap's location.







Sitemap with errors and Sitemap without errors


Updated on 7/14/2008

How to submit more than 100 posts to Google Sitemap



ArpitNext has commented out - Thanks ArpitNext - that Google Sitemap refers the latest 25 posts from Blogger which I am not sure the exact number.

However there is a still way to submit your all of your posts.



If you have more than 100 posts and want to post all to Google Sitemap, add the below:

atom.xml?redirect=false&start-index=1&max-results=100

atom.xml?redirect=false&start-index=101&max-results=100


If you have more than 200 posts and want to post all to Google Sitemap, add the below:

atom.xml?redirect=false&start-index=1&max-results=100

atom.xml?redirect=false&start-index=101&max-results=100

atom.xml?redirect=false&start-index=201&max-results=100


If you have more than 300 posts and want to post all to Google Sitemap, add the below:

atom.xml?redirect=false&start-index=1&max-results=100

atom.xml?redirect=false&start-index=101&max-results=100

atom.xml?redirect=false&start-index=201&max-results=100

atom.xml?redirect=false&start-index=301&max-results=100


As you can see the above, start-index is the post number to start returning results from and max-results is the how many posts you want returned from whatever the number you state on start-index. The maximum max-results is 500 (from many blogger) but to be safe, it is recommended to put 100.
